If smoother (but not smooth) is preferable, a trick I employ on rough G10 is "buffing" the scales for about 15 minutes apiece on an old pair of jeans. I've never done this to a Spydie, but I do it to all of my Emersons; it basically provides several weeks/months of pocket wear without generating any nasty G10 dust (like sanding would).

I just swapped the scale with Flytanium Ti scale. The knife is now perfect. The heavier blade is really made for the titanium scale. The knife is now much better balanced because it’s blade heavy. With the original g-10 handle, the waved PM2 looks like a muscular dude with skinny leg.
The new configuration with Ti scale and Lynch clip weighs 5.35oz which is slightly heavier than the Sebenza/Inkosi/Zaan but it has much more robust blade. The ZT0562Ti weighs about the same.
A normal PM2 with the same flytanium scale and lynch clip weights 4.95oz, so overall the wave only adds 0.4oz more. IMO the skinny FFG blade really doesn’t suit the Flytanium scale well because the blade is too light and too handle heavy, so it’s not balanced.
